在前端开发中,我们常常需要对一组数据进行展示或处理,multic 就是一个能够快速生成多种图表的 npm 包。它不仅支持基本的线图和柱状图,还支持箱形图、散点图、热力图等多种类型,拥有丰富的配置选项,灵活易用,非常适合快速搭建复杂的可视化系统。
安装 multic
在命令行中输入以下命令即可安装 multic:
--- ------- ------
如果你已经在项目中使用了 vue 或 react,也可以按需安装 multic-vue 或 multic-react。
使用 multic
使用 multic 能够快速生成多种类型的图表,只需要基本的数据和配置信息即可。
下面我们使用一个简单的例子来演示 multic 的使用方法。我们假设我们有一组销售数据,需要将它们以柱状图的形式展示出来。
创建 DOM
首先,在 HTML 文件中添加一个 div 标签,用于容纳 multic 生成的图表:
---- -----------------
数据准备
我们假设有以下的销售数据:
----- --------- - - ---- ---- ---- ---- ---- ---- ---- ---- ---- ---- ---- ---- ---- ---- ---- ---- ---- ---- ---- ---- ---- ---- ---- --- --
配置选项
然后,我们需要为 multic 设定配置选项,以下是需要的基本选项:
----- ------- - - ------ - ----- ----- -- ------ ------ --- --- ----- ------ - ----------- ---------------------- -- ------- - - ----- ------------------------ - - --
我们可以通过修改 chart
选项来改变图像类型,比如将柱状图改为线图、饼图和散点图等。title
选项用于为图表添加标题。
处理数据
我们还需要将数据处理成 multic 能够识别的格式。以下是处理数据的代码:
----- ---- - ----------------------- ----- ------ - ------------------------- ----- ---------- - -------------- ------ -- -- ----- ---- -- ------------- ----
生成图表
最后,我们可以使用以下代码创建一个 multic 图表:
------ ------ ---- --------- ----- ------- - --------------------------------- ----- ----- - --------------- ---------
现在,我们已经成功生成了一个简单的柱状图。完整代码如下:
--------- ----- ------ ------ ------------- ---------- ------- ------ ---- ----------------- ------- --------------------------------------------------- -------- ----- --------- - - ---- ---- ---- ---- ---- ---- ---- ---- ---- ---- ---- ---- ---- ---- ---- ---- ---- ---- ---- ---- ---- ---- ---- --- -- ----- ------- - - ------ - ----- ----- -- ------ ------ --- --- ----- ------ - ----------- ---------------------- -- ------- - - ----- ------------------------ - - -- ----- ---- - ----------------------- ----- ------ - ------------------------- ----- ---------- - -------------- ------ -- -- ----- ---- -- ------------- ---- ----- ------- - --------------------------------- ----- ----- - --------------- --------- --------- ------- -------
常用选项
以下是一些常用的 multic 配置选项:
chart
用于设置图表类型,比如线图、柱状图和饼图等。示例:
------ - ----- -------- -
title
用于为图表添加标题。示例:
------ ------ --- --- -----
xAxis
用于设置 x 轴相关信息。示例:
------ - ----------- ------- ------ ------ ------ ------ ------ -
yAxis
用于设置 y 轴相关信息。示例:
------ - ------ - ----- ------- - -
series
用于设置系列数据。示例:
------- - - ----- ----- ---- ---- ---- ---- ---- - -
结语
multic 是一款非常优秀的 npm 包,提供了灵活的配置选项和多种图表类型。通过本教程的学习,相信大家能够快速掌握 multic 的使用方法,加速前端可视化开发的进程。
来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/73509